Just because he's 7 doesn't mean that he has experienced floors like you have. But, I also agree that it may be because it is cold and slippery. Especially now that it is colder, Joey will make a bee-line for a throw rug if asked to do a sit or a down on the tile ("It still counts if I do it over here, right? Right?" Pretty cute!).
In any case, what I would do is scatter treats on the scary floors when he's not looking. When I wanted to give him a new toy, I'd leave it for him to find on the scary floor. IOW, I'd make those scary floors a great place for a dog to be!
